Output c63fca926d72e879a9441353a2ca13eca2c9a0de849d9e3683f8ad823acd0b03:1

value
1081539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ea88e91db047a71f881283a39923e0d6d6e8d557 OP_EQUAL
address
3P5849Y2tsVMNHsupXAmcUehrDxNUCpph4
transaction
c63fca926d72e879a9441353a2ca13eca2c9a0de849d9e3683f8ad823acd0b03
confirmations
158527
spent
true